Lines Matching defs:rules
58 * A policy contains a set of rules associated with a collection of
113 private Map rules = new HashMap();
552 return (new HashSet(rules.keySet()));
568 Rule rule = (Rule) rules.get(ruleName);
596 if (rules.containsKey(rule.getName())) {
600 } else if (rules.containsValue(rule)) {
606 rules.put(rule.getName(), rule);
629 rules.put(rule.getName(), rule);
644 return ((Rule) rules.remove(ruleName));
1345 if (rules.equals(p.rules) && users.equals(p.users)
1358 * name, rules, subjects, referrals and conditions
1379 // Copy rules
1380 answer.rules = new HashMap();
1381 Iterator items = rules.keySet().iterator();
1384 Rule rule = (Rule) rules.get(o);
1385 answer.rules.put(o, rule.clone());
1702 //Process rules
1703 Iterator ruleIterator = rules.values().iterator();
1772 Iterator ruleIterator = rules.values().iterator();
1826 Iterator ruleIterator = rules.values().iterator();
2624 * Subjects, Conditions and rules of this policy object.
2628 prWeight = rules.size() * ruleWeight;